Vue3 TypeScript Vite如何用require动态引入图片等静态资源?
- 内容介绍
- 文章标签
- 相关推荐
本文共计557个文字,预计阅读时间需要3分钟。
问题:Vue3 + TypeScript + Vite 项目中如何使用 require 动态引入类资源?描述:今天在开发 Vue3 + TypeScript + Vite 项目时,需要动态引入类资源,例如图片等静态资源。
问题:Vue3+TypeScript+Vite的项目中如何使用require动态引入类似于图片等静态资源!
描述:今天在开发项目时(项目框架为Vue3+TypeScript+Vite)需要 动态引入静态资源,也就是img标签的src属性值为动态获取,按照以往的做法直接是require引入即可,如下代码:
<img class="demo" :src="require(`../../../assets/image/${item.img}`)" />
写上后代码波浪线报错,报错提示:
找不到名称 “require”。是否需要为节点安装类型定义? 请尝试使用
npm i --save-dev @types/node。
本文共计557个文字,预计阅读时间需要3分钟。
问题:Vue3 + TypeScript + Vite 项目中如何使用 require 动态引入类资源?描述:今天在开发 Vue3 + TypeScript + Vite 项目时,需要动态引入类资源,例如图片等静态资源。
问题:Vue3+TypeScript+Vite的项目中如何使用require动态引入类似于图片等静态资源!
描述:今天在开发项目时(项目框架为Vue3+TypeScript+Vite)需要 动态引入静态资源,也就是img标签的src属性值为动态获取,按照以往的做法直接是require引入即可,如下代码:
<img class="demo" :src="require(`../../../assets/image/${item.img}`)" />
写上后代码波浪线报错,报错提示:
找不到名称 “require”。是否需要为节点安装类型定义? 请尝试使用
npm i --save-dev @types/node。

